Higher Education Administrator (Student Success & Development)
Career GuideKey Responsibilities
- Develop and manage student support programs.
- Collaborate with faculty and staff to enhance student experiences.
- Monitor and assess student progress and success metrics.
- Advise students on academic and personal development.
- Implement policies that promote diversity and inclusion.

Salary & Demand
Median Salary Range
Entry Level$40,000 - $55,000
Mid Level$55,000 - $75,000
Senior Level$75,000 - $100,000
Growth Trend
Moderate growth expected as institutions focus more on student retention and success.Companies Hiring
